Dialysis Technician Job Market in Pullman

The local job market in Pullman features about six employed dialysis technicians, indicating a niche but stable opportunity for entry into the profession. While the cost-of-living index sits at 107.4, slightly higher than the national average, it allows for a comfortable standard of living for techs in this region. Among employers, outpatient dialysis chains like Fresenius and DaVita dominate, employing roughly 90% of technicians and establishing competitive pay scales. The disparity in salaries often stems from various factors such as shift differentials for early and late hours, added premiums for home dialysis training roles, and the potential for higher pay through charge or lead technician positions. Those looking to maximize their dialysis technician salary in Pullman, WA, should consider seeking certifications from recognized bodies like NNCC, BONENT, or NNCO, as this can lead to increased earnings and more advanced opportunities in a market that continues to grow with the evolving demand for at-home care.

Can dialysis technicians make $100K in Pullman?

The median dialysis technician salary in Pullman is $52,595, and the 90th percentile earns $81,521. Reaching $100K in this market typically requires a combination of advanced certifications, working at multiple practices, or transitioning into education or consulting roles.
